    82 GS650GL Light switch

    I look every where on the handle bar of my bike trying to locate the light switch or Hi/Lo beam switch and I can't find it. Would you kind enough to guide me to the right location or there isn't one for this bike?

    Thanks,

    #2
    Not exactly sure but if it is like my 550L, the turn signal switch will move up and down to turn on high or low beams. My 81 650g (no L) has a separate switch to turn on high beams as well as a headlight on and off switch. I believe these were phased out by 82. I assume you are aware of the position of turn signal switch on left side of handlebars.

      Thanks for reply. The turn signal only can go left or right. I did try to see if it can push in and confirm it can't.

      On the Tachmeter, there is a light which says high beam. So, there should be a switch to activate this and somehow I can't locate this. Unless, the bike I had got modified by the previous owner which he wires the light directly without any switch.

        high low headlight switch

        the high low switch on my 83 gs 650L is the turn switch also. It moves right and left for the turn indcator, and up and down (towards the sky and toward the ground ) for high and low. your 82 sounds just like my 83 so I would take a second look.

          My 82650E is the same, signal left and right, up for high beam, down for low beam.
